Matanga, of Hindi origin, means 'sage' or 'advisor to Devi Lalita', the goddess in Hindu tradition. It carries connotations of wisdom, spirituality, and leadership, often associated with revered figures in mythology. The name reflects a deep cultural and religious significance in Indian contexts.
